Book Overview

Oscar Wilde wrote a lot, from criticism, articles, and reviews to novels, poetry, short tales, plays, and even children's writing. Among them are two of his masterworks, masterpieces that won him awards and cemented his reputation as a writer. The Importance of Being Earnest, a play that has been revived many times and adapted for radio, television, film, operas, and musicals, and The Picture of Dorian Gray, Wilde's only novel that became his most-read and well-known work, are both contained in this beautiful hardbound edition with gilded edges and beautiful endpapers.

About Oscar Wilde

Oscar Wilde (1854-1900) was an Irish writer, poet, and playwright. His novel, The Picture of Dorian Gray, brought him lasting recognition, and he became one of the most successful playwrights of the late Victorian era with a series of witty social satires, including his masterpiece, The Importance of Being Earnest.
